Subject: Handover — validator plugin stuff

Hey Priya,

Passing you the baton on Checkwright, our plugin system for data validators. The new schema-drift plugin shipped Tuesday and mostly behaves, but it occasionally flags empty CSV uploads as "malformed" — harmless, just noisy. I've muted the alert until Friday. If support escalates anything about plugin load failures, the fix is usually bumping the registry cache. Questions after I'm off? Reach the Checkwright maintainers at the address below.

billing contact of hawip-kahif = zorwyn@tolvaqlabs.corp

**Q: Where do I find the stale-cache postmortem for Pebblecart?**

The full write-up lives in the Hollowfen incident archive under INC review 7. It covers why the Pebblecart pricing cache served stale entries for six hours. The archive vault is encrypted; new contractors unlock it with the passphrase noted immediately below.

vault phrase of kawep-tahog = ulaix-briath

## Formula sandbox tuning

User-supplied formulas in Gridmoor execute inside a restricted interpreter with hard ceilings on time, memory, and call depth. Reviewers should confirm any change to these ceilings is justified in the PR description, since raising them widens the abuse surface. Defaults were chosen from production traces. The current limits are as follows.

limits module of tafog-fawip:
WEIGHTS = {
    "julix": 57,
    "lamys": 992,
    "kasvan": 209,
    "quenok": 750,
    "alddor": 259,
    "oliath": 1009,
    "wenix": 815,
}

Contract renews annually; auto-renew is OFF. Experiment config lives in the pricing-flags repo, branch exp-tiered. Do not delete the holdout segment — finance still reconciles against it. Vendor invoices arrive monthly and must be matched to the experiment ledger before approval. Any changes to variant weights require vendor sign-off per the SLA. For vendor-side questions or ledger discrepancies, contact the Pricecraft account team.

billing contact of tahaf-kafop = istwyn_fraox@norvaworks.corp